Went to the local work boat terminal and snapped a lot of pictures. Still learning to shoot correct exposure and composition so feedback is appreciated. Made a rookie mistake and got a smudge on the upper side of the lens need to remember to watch the lens cleanliness. Also learned that the D200 seems to underexpose a bit at least in these lighting conditions so Im glad I took plent of shots with +.3 and +.7 exposure settings.

Feedback on composition and exposure are greatly appreciated.
